How Can You Maximize the Use of Your Body Fat Scale?

To effectively maximize the use of your body fat scale, consider the following strategies:

  • Regular Measurements: Consistency is key when using a body fat scale. Take measurements at the same time each day, ideally in the morning after waking up and using the restroom, to ensure minimal variations due to hydration or food intake.
  • Proper Setup: Ensure your scale is placed on a hard, flat surface for accurate readings. Avoid using it on carpet or uneven flooring, as this can lead to inconsistencies in the results.
  • Hydration Levels: Be mindful of your hydration status before taking measurements. Body fat scales often use bioelectrical impedance analysis, which can be affected by how hydrated you are, so try to measure under similar hydration conditions for the most reliable results.
  • Track Trends Over Time: Instead of focusing on daily fluctuations, keep a log of your body fat percentage over weeks or months. This will help you see trends and changes in your body composition more clearly, providing a better understanding of your health journey.
  • Complement with Other Measurements: Use your body fat scale in conjunction with other metrics such as weight, waist circumference, and how your clothes fit. This holistic approach gives you a more complete picture of your health and fitness progress.
  • Understand the Limitations: Recognize that body fat scales can vary in accuracy and may not always provide precise readings. Factors such as body type, muscle mass, and scale technology can impact results, so use them as a general guideline rather than an absolute measurement.

What Are the Common Limitations of Body Fat Scales?

Body fat scales are popular tools for tracking body composition, but they come with several limitations.

  • Accuracy: Body fat scales often provide estimates rather than precise measurements. They typically use bioelectrical impedance analysis (BIA), which can be influenced by factors such as hydration levels, recent meals, and even the time of day, leading to fluctuating results.
  • Body Composition Variability: The scales may not accurately differentiate between fat mass, lean mass, and water weight. This means someone could see a decrease in body fat percentage even if they have lost muscle mass instead of fat, misleading their fitness progress.
  • Calibration Issues: Many scales require regular calibration to maintain accuracy, and improper use can lead to inconsistent readings. Users often overlook this maintenance, resulting in skewed data that doesn’t reflect true body composition changes.
  • User Factors: Individual differences such as age, gender, and fitness level can significantly affect the readings. Body fat scales may not account for these factors, leading to inaccurate assessments, especially for athletes or those with higher muscle mass.
  • Limited Insight: While these scales provide a body fat percentage, they do not offer insights into fat distribution or the health implications of body composition. Understanding where fat is distributed on the body is crucial for assessing health risks, which these scales do not measure.
